DESCRIPTION
The SMH4811A is designed to control hot swapping of
plug-in cards operating from a single supply ranging from
20V to 500V. It provides under-voltage and over-voltage
monitoring of the host power supply, drives an external
power MOSFET switch that connects the supply to the
load, and also protects against over-current conditions
that might disrupt the host supply. When the input and
output voltages to its controls are within specification, it
provides a Power Good logic output that may be used to
turn loads on (e.g., an isolated-output DC-DC converter,
or drive a LED status light). Additional features of the
SMH4811A include: temperature sense or master enable
input, 2.5V and 5V reference outputs for expanding moni-
tor functions, two Pin-Detect enable inputs for fault protec-
tion, and duty-cycle over-current protection.

PIN DESCRIPTIONS
DRAIN SENSE (1)
The DRAIN SENSE input monitors the voltage at the drain
of the external power MOSFET switch with respect to V
SS
.
An internal 10µA source pulls the DRAIN SENSE signal
towards the 5V reference level. DRAIN SENSE must be
held below 2.5V to enable the PG outputs.
VGATE (2)
The VGATE output activates an external power MOSFET
switch. This signal supplies a constant current output
(100µA typical), which allows easy adjustment of the
MOSFET turn on slew rate.
EN/TS (3)
The Enable/Temperature Sense input is the master en-
able input. If EN/TS is less than 2.5V, VGATE will be
disabled. This pin has an internal 200kΩ pull-up to 5V.
PD1# and PD2# (4 & 5)
These are logic level active low inputs that can optionally
be employed to enable VGATE and the PG outputs when
they are at V
SS
. These pins each have an internal 50kΩ
pull-up to 5V.
FAULT# (6)
This is an open-drain, active-low output that indicates the
fault status of the device.
CBSENSE (7)
The circuit breaker sense input is used to detect over-
current conditions across an external, low value sense
resistor (R
S
) tied in series with the Power MOSFET. A
voltage drop of greater than 50mV across the resistor for
longer than t
CBD
will trip the circuit breaker. A program-
mable Quick-Trip™ sense point is also available.
UV (9)
The UV pin is used as an under-voltage supply monitor,
typically in conjunction with an external resistor ladder.
VGATE will be disabled if UV is less than 2.5V. Program-
mable internal hysteresis is available on the UV input,
adjustable in increments of 62.5mV. Also available is a
filter delay on the UV input.
OV (10)
The OV pin is used as an over-voltage supply monitor,
typically in conjunction with an external resistor ladder.
VGATE will be disabled if OV is greater than 2.5V. A filter
delay is available on the OV input.
5.0VREF & 2.5VREF (11 & 12)
These are precision 5V and 2.5V output reference volt-
ages that may be use to expand the logic input functions
on the SMH4803A. The reference outputs are with re-
spect to V
SS
.
ENPG (14)
This is an active high input that controls the PG# output.
When ENPG is pulled low the PG# output is immediately
placed in a high impedance state. This pin has an internal
50kΩ pull-up to 5V.
PG# (15)
The PG# pin is an open-drain, active-low output with no
internal pull-up resistor. It can be used to switch a load or
enable a DC/DC converter. PG# is enabled immediately
after VGATE reaches V
DD
– V
GT
and the DRAIN SENSE
voltage is less than 2.5V. Voltage on these pins cannot
exceed 12V, as referenced to V
SS.
V
DD
(16)
V
DD
is the positive supply connection. An internal shunt
regulator limits the voltage on this pin to approximately
12V with respect to VSS. A resistor must be placed in
series with the V
DD
pin to limit the regulator current (R
D
in
the application illustrations).
V
SS
(8)
V
SS
is connected to the negative side of the supply.

*COMMENT
Stresses listed under Absolute Maximum Ratings may cause perma-
nent damage to the device. These are stress ratings only, and
functional operation of the device at these or any other conditions
outside those listed in the operational sections of this specification is not
implied. Exposure to any absolute maximum rating for extended
periods may affect device performance and reliability.
